Our story
Most of the factories we walked into were running blind.
Between us we have spent the better part of fifteen years inside Canadian factories — breweries, dairies, food processors, moulding shops, greenhouses. Not in the front office. On the floor at three in the morning with the sanitation crew, in the compressor room with the millwright, up a ladder over a pasteurizer with a clipboard.
And the same thing was true in nearly every one of them. The factory ran on gut instinct, a monthly utility bill and whatever somebody happened to notice walking past. Millions of dollars of equipment, and the only number anyone could put a date on arrived in the mail four weeks after the money was already gone. Good operators. Careful people. Making decisions in the dark.
We tried to fix that the way the industry fixes it — with audits and reports. A report is right the day you hand it over and stale the week after. So in 2021 we stopped writing them and put everything we had into building the company we had wanted to hire: one that installs permanent instruments on the equipment, keeps them running, and stays in the room every month with the people who actually turn the valves.
There has not been a moment when that mattered more. Canadian manufacturers are being asked to make more for less, against competitors with cheaper energy and newer factories, and a great deal of the country's floor space is still running analog. A factory that can see itself can defend itself. That is why Quantify Environmental exists, and it is why the founders are in a truck on the way to your factory rather than on a call from somewhere else.

We install it ourselves
Design, order, build and install the sensor network. One to two days on site, usually without stopping the line, and no subcontractors on your floor.
We stay on the monthly review
The dashboard finds it; the review makes sure it gets fixed. That second half is where the savings actually land, and it is the half most vendors skip.
We build on what you have
Existing meters, PLCs with 4-20 mA outputs, legacy SCADA, spreadsheets your team already keeps — we bring them in. We don't rip things out.

What does an industrial IoT integrator actually do?
An industrial IoT integrator puts permanent instruments on equipment that had none, gets the readings off the floor, and puts them somewhere a person can act on them. For Quantify Environmental that means designing the sensor network for your factory, buying and building it, installing it ourselves, pulling in whatever your existing meters, PLCs and legacy SCADA already produce, and streaming all of it to one dashboard — then sitting down with your team every month to work out what the numbers are telling you.
Where is Quantify Environmental based, and how far do you travel?
Quantify Environmental is based in Guelph, Ontario, and the founders drive to the factory. The company serves Ontario, Quebec, Alberta and British Columbia, and one client rollout alone covers eight facilities across Ontario, Alberta and Quebec. Being close enough to show up is part of the model rather than a limitation of it — the monthly review happens with the people who turn the valves, not over a screen share from somewhere else.
Do you subcontract the installation?
No. Quantify designs, orders, builds and installs the sensor network itself — white glove, no subcontractors. The same people who walk the factory during the assessment are the people on the ladder during the install and on the call during the monthly review. That is deliberate: hand-offs are where the context about your factory gets lost, and the context is most of the value.
How long has Quantify Environmental been doing this?
Quantify Environmental was founded in Guelph, Ontario in 2021 by Dave Fox and Tom Ulanowski, who between them had already spent well over a decade working inside Canadian factories — energy auditing on one side, automating production facilities on the other. The company is younger than the experience behind it, which is the honest way to put it.
